3. The Petitioner is in custody since 19th January, 2022 in connection with Phiringia P.S. Case No.78/2020 corresponding to C.T. Case No.51/2020 pending in the court of learned District and sessions Judge-cum-Special Judge, Phulbani for the alleged commission of the offence under Section 20(b)(ii)(C )/25/29 of the NDPS Act.

// 2 //

5. The allegation is that the Petitioner and another person were apprehended while they were transporting huge quantity of ganja in the Maruti car. However, from the materials on record, it revealed that the Petitioner has been implicated in the case on the basis of the statement of co-accused namely, Anamika Digal, and nothing was seized from his possession.

6. Considering the above facts and taking into account the period of detention of the Petitioner in custody, I am inclined to allow the prayer for bail. Let the Petitioner be released on bail on such terms and conditions as may be imposed by the court in seisin over the matter in the aforesaid case including the conditions that he shall appear before the trial court on each date of posting of the case without fail.

7. The BLAPL is disposed of.
